About Bounce
Short term storage on every block of the city, hosted by local businesses.
Bounce’s vision is to build a layer of infrastructure over urban areas that enable seamless pickup and dropoff of “things.” Ultimately, “cloud computing for the physical world.” The first piece of this has been getting storage locations all over dense urban areas and allowing people to store things there - it’s been very popular with travelers leaving luggage and commuters stashing a gym bag, work bag, etc. This is our core product and what will drive most of our revenue in the short term. Additionally, we’ll be building the next layer up of the platform - think delivery, further utilization of spaces, etc. There’s a ton more to dive into on what all this means.
